There are several ways to figure out the main points of a parable:

  1. Read the context: Understand the background and setting of the parable to gain insights into its main points.
  2. Consider the main point in each character: Analyze the characteristics and actions of each character to determine the central message of the parable.
  3. Combine both: By reading the context and analyzing the characters, you can gain a comprehensive understanding of the main points of the parable.
